Okay, if you haven't already done it then get over to gamesradar.com. Check out the download section and look at PN 03 and Viewtiful Joe videos. They. Look. Amazing.

Viewtiful Joe is the cartoon superhero game - it's some sort of side scrolling beat 'em up, but better than it sounds because the action kind of branches off. It looks hella cool, all teh characters are kind of small with biggish heads - not deformed, you understand, but a cartoon style. And it's the best example of cel-shading I have ever seen. It's just how it should be - so you don't notice straight away.

PN03 also looks absolutely brilliant. It's all laser gun action with amazing acrobatic stunts and doging maneouvres - expect to be able to do some pretty amazing stuff in this game. Rather than cartoon style it is a realistic game, with the main character being some sort of gun wielding biatch.

I'd highly advise you to download both videos if at all possible - if you don't have much space then just delete them straight afterwards, because these videos will change your life*. They've certainly impressed me and made me a lot more excited about them. I'll probably pre-order them next time I get the chance, although I'm not sure you can yet.


*May not be true.
